Output 09c5a0b64f94607b66e78058a5bef018d1f342152b9556fcaf014ee468a17538:0

value
1015066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e272ffb76dc073d27fa773fc486488323de5b42b OP_EQUALVERIFY OP_CHECKSIG
address
1MeMUcmxzEgEgrWgKACMg3DZjcULAZmVci
transaction
09c5a0b64f94607b66e78058a5bef018d1f342152b9556fcaf014ee468a17538
confirmations
651175
spent
true